Understanding PayTech First things first, let's explain how PayTech sits within the larger FinTech universe, shall we? At its heart, PayTech is the evolution driver (sorry Darwin) of how money moves around the globe. It's the magic behind your seamless online transactions, the mobile payments that make shopping so easy, and the cutting-edge security making sure your data stays safe and sound. Now, global digital payments volume is skyrocketing, expected to hit a whopping $8.49 trillion by 2025, according to a Statista report. PayTech is transforming not just how we buy our morning coffee but reshaping global commerce itself. It breaks down barriers, making financial services accessible to previously underserved communities, and enables the seamless flow of transactions across borders.
